WebJun 5, 2024 · Rental income does count as investment income concerning the EIC. While investment income cannot help some to qualify for the EIC, it can disqualify someone from the EIC. If rental income does show a profit, and that profit combined with other investment income is greater than $3,500, then it disqualifies a filer from receiving the EIC..
